Court again rejects bail plea of Shahadat’s wife

A Dhaka court yesterday once again rejected the bail prayer of Jesmin Jahan Nitto, wife of suspended national cricketer Sahadat Hossain, in a case filed for torturing their housemaid.

Dhaka Metropolitan Magistrate Amirul Haidar Chowdhury rejected the plea.

Shahadat’s counsel said: ‘‘She has a breast-feeding baby of nine months who needs her mother badly. She has been languishing in jail for 13 days. So her bail may be allowed.”

On October 4, police arrested Nitto in Pabna Lane in the Malibagh area of the capital in connection with the case. Later, a court sent her to jail after rejecting her bail petition while her husband was still on the run.

Meanwhile, Shahadat was sent to jail on Tuesday as Court rejected his bail plea as well after the completion of his three-day remand in the same case.
